HiSilicon Kirin 970 or Intel Core i5-5200U - which processor is faster? In this comparison we look at the differences and analyze which of these two CPUs is better. We compare the technical data and benchmark results.

The HiSilicon Kirin 970 has 8 cores with 8 threads and clocks with a maximum frequency of 2.40 GHz. Up to 8 GB of memory is supported in 4 memory channels. The HiSilicon Kirin 970 was released in Q3/2017.

The Intel Core i5-5200U has 2 cores with 4 threads and clocks with a maximum frequency of 2.70 GHz. The CPU supports up to 16 GB of memory in 2 memory channels. The Intel Core i5-5200U was released in Q1/2015.

Geekbench 5, 64bit (Multi-Core)

Geekbench 5 is a cross plattform benchmark that heavily uses the systems memory. A fast memory will push the result a lot. The multi-core test involves all CPU cores and taks a big advantage of hyperthreading.
HiSilicon Kirin 970 HiSilicon Kirin 970
8C 8T @ 2.40 GHz
1455 (100%)
Intel Core i5-5200U Intel Core i5-5200U
2C 4T @ 2.50 GHz
1438 (99%)
